Marguerita Fisher is the neglected wife of Stannard, a very busy business man, plays a first rate lead in this two-reel drama, which illustrates the doubtful truth that a woman's love is won and kept by force. As shown in this picture, the husband, on the evidence of an old friend, employs stone age tactics and we see the couple reunited in that primitive atmosphere. The story is simple and clearly presented and the film ought to be well received. - The Moving Picture World, November 1, 1913
